Home
last modified time | relevance | path

Searched refs:CreateUnreachable (Results 1 – 25 of 30) sorted by relevance

12

/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GException.cpp577 CGF.Builder.CreateUnreachable(); in emitFilterDispatchBlock()
1304 Builder.CreateUnreachable(); in ExitCXXTryStmt()
1411 CGF.Builder.CreateUnreachable(); in Emit()
1559 Builder.CreateUnreachable(); in getTerminateLandingPad()
1583 Builder.CreateUnreachable(); in getTerminateHandler()
1618 Builder.CreateUnreachable(); in getTerminateFunclet()
1643 Builder.CreateUnreachable(); in getEHResumeBlock()
2291 Builder.CreateUnreachable(); in EmitSEHLeaveStmt()
H A DCodeGenFunction.cpp1585 Builder.CreateUnreachable(); in GenerateCode()
2923 Builder.CreateUnreachable(); in EmitAArch64MultiVersionResolver()
2963 Builder.CreateUnreachable(); in EmitX86MultiVersionResolver()
H A DItaniumCXXABI.cpp1587 CGF.Builder.CreateUnreachable(); in EmitBadTypeidCall()
1787 CGF.Builder.CreateUnreachable(); in EmitBadCastCall()
5077 builder.CreateUnreachable(); in getClangCallTerminateFn()
H A DCGCall.cpp3789 Builder.CreateUnreachable(); in EmitFunctionEpilog()
4106 llvm::Instruction *isActive = Builder.CreateUnreachable(); in EmitDelegateCallArg()
4842 Builder.CreateUnreachable(); in EmitNoreturnRuntimeCallOrInvoke()
H A DCGExprCXX.cpp1730 cleanupDominator = Builder.CreateUnreachable(); in EmitCXXNewExpr()
H A DCGExpr.cpp3516 CGF.Builder.CreateUnreachable(); in emitCheckHandlerCall()
3826 Builder.CreateUnreachable(); in EmitUnreachable()
3868 Builder.CreateUnreachable(); in EmitTrapCheck()
H A DCGObjCMac.cpp4872 CGF.Builder.CreateUnreachable(); in EmitTryOrSynchronizedStmt()
4895 CGF.Builder.CreateUnreachable(); in EmitThrowStmt()
7786 CGF.Builder.CreateUnreachable(); in EmitThrowStmt()
H A DCGStmt.cpp1481 Builder.CreateUnreachable(); in EmitReturnStmt()
H A DCGClass.cpp1451 Builder.CreateUnreachable(); in EmitDestructorBody()
H A DCGObjC.cpp4078 CGF.Builder.CreateUnreachable(); in emitAtAvailableLinkGuard()
H A DCGObjCGNU.cpp4201 CGF.Builder.CreateUnreachable(); in EmitThrowStmt()
/freebsd/contrib/llvm-project/llvm/lib/Target/WebAssembly/
H A DWebAssemblyLowerEmscriptenEHSjLj.cpp735 IRB.CreateUnreachable(); in wrapTestSetjmp()
1127 IRB.CreateUnreachable(); in runEHOnFunction()
1171 IRB.CreateUnreachable(); in runEHOnFunction()
1486 IRB.CreateUnreachable(); in handleLongjmpableCallsForEmscriptenSjLj()
1636 IRB.CreateUnreachable(); in handleLongjmpableCallsForWasmSjLj()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Instrumentation/
H A DBoundsChecking.cpp210 IRB.CreateUnreachable(); in addBoundsChecking()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DJumpTableToSwitch.cpp109 BuilderUnreachable.CreateUnreachable(); in expandToSwitch()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/
H A DWasmEHPrepare.cpp214 IRB.CreateUnreachable(); in prepareThrows()
H A DStackProtector.cpp715 B.CreateUnreachable();
H A DAtomicExpandPass.cpp1444 Builder.CreateUnreachable(); in expandAtomicCmpXchg()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Coroutines/
H A DCoroSplit.cpp788 Builder.CreateUnreachable(); in replaceEntryBlock()
1561 Builder.CreateUnreachable(); in createResumeEntryBlock()
H A DCoroFrame.cpp2151 Builder.CreateUnreachable(); in rewritePHIsForCleanupPad()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Vectorize/
H A DVPlan.cpp514 UnreachableInst *Terminator = State->Builder.CreateUnreachable(); in execute()
/freebsd/contrib/llvm-project/llvm/lib/Frontend/OpenMP/
H A DOMPIRBuilder.cpp995 auto *UI = Builder.CreateUnreachable(); in createCancel()
3714 Builder.CreateUnreachable(); in createReductions()
6110 auto *UI = Builder.CreateUnreachable(); in createTargetInit()
7900 CurBBTI = CurBBTI ? CurBBTI : Builder.CreateUnreachable(); in emitAtomicUpdate()
8053 CurBBTI = CurBBTI ? CurBBTI : Builder.CreateUnreachable(); in createAtomicCompare()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/
H A DLoopUtils.cpp588 Builder.CreateUnreachable(); in deleteDeadLoop()
H A DSimplifyCFG.cpp7291 Builder.CreateUnreachable(); in TryToMergeLandingPad()
7722 Builder.CreateUnreachable(); in removeUndefIntroducingPredecessor()
7748 Builder.CreateUnreachable(); in removeUndefIntroducingPredecessor()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/IPO/
H A DLowerTypeTests.cpp1558 IRB.CreateUnreachable(); in createJumpTable()
/freebsd/contrib/llvm-project/llvm/include/llvm/IR/
H A DIRBuilder.h1268 UnreachableInst *CreateUnreachable() { in CreateUnreachable() function

12